27 votes

Comment modifier le modèle de processus sur un projet d'équipe existant dans TFS 2010?

Comment changer le modèle de processus en MSF pour Agile sur un projet d'équipe déjà existant dans TFS 2010?

Nous avons mis à niveau notre TFS 2008 à 2010, et maintenant je voudrais également changer le modèle de processus en MSF pour Agile (actuellement CMMI). Nous n'avons pas beaucoup utilisé la fonctionnalité de l'élément de travail, donc si certaines informations se perdent dans la conversion, peu importe.

34voto

Joe Future Points 696

Une fois que vous avez créé un Projet d'Équipe, malheureusement vous ne pouvez pas télécharger un nouveau modèle de processus. Comme Robaticus dit, vous devrez télécharger le fichier XML pour le modèle et le modifier, puis re-télécharger. La puissance de l'outil vous permet de créer de NOUVEAUX modèles pour de NOUVEAUX projets de l'équipe, mais il ne sera pas en modifier un existant.

Au lieu de cela, vous pouvez utiliser le witadmin.exe outil (sur n'importe quel ordinateur avec Team Explorer est installé, sous \Program Files (x86)\Microsoft Visual Studio 10.0\Common7\IDE, ou tout simplement à partir d'une Invite de Commande Visual Studio) pour exporter la workitem définitions et de les réimporter une fois que vous avez fait vos modifications.

Heureusement, si vous ne l'utilisez pas workitem suivi de beaucoup, cela pourrait être pas trop difficile. Vous pourriez être en mesure de simplement supprimer tous les workitem types et puis re-télécharger les nouveaux types.

Si c'est trop de problèmes, pensez à combien vous souhaitez conserver votre contrôle de la source de l'histoire. Il pourrait être intéressant de créer une nouvelle Équipe de Projet avec le modèle Agile et puis il suffit de déplacer tous vos code source en elle.

4voto

Chris S Points 32376

Vous ne pouvez pas changer le modèle de processus, cependant, vous pouvez modifier les types d'élément de travail. Donc, pour les bugs, tâches, vous pouvez passer à l'Agile définitions.

Vous pouvez le faire en 2010, avec witadmin, en 2008 il est importwit, en téléchargeant d'abord le modèle à disque (vous aurez besoin de la TSF de la puissance de ce type d'outils). Alors point de l'application de console à bug.xml, task.xml etc..

Utilisation: witadmin importwitd /collection:collectionurl [/p:projet] /f:filename [/e:encodage] [/v]

 /collection Spécifie l'Équipe de projet de la Fondation de la collection. Utiliser une URL complètement spécifiée comme
http://servername:8080/tfs/Collection0.
 /p Spécifie le projet d'équipe dans lequel le nouveau type d'élément de travail est importé. C'est obligatoire, sauf lorsque
 la validation de la seule option est utilisée.
 /f Spécifie le type d'élément de travail de définition XML fichier à importer.
 /e Spécifie le nom de l' .NET Framework 2.0 encodage utilisé pour importer le fichier XML. Par exemple,
 /e:utf-7 utilise Unicode (UTF-7) l'encodage. L'encodage est détecté automatiquement chaque fois que possible. Si
 l'encodage ne peut pas être détecté, UTF-8 est utilisé.
 /v Valide les définitions XML pour le type d'élément de travail, type de lien, ou de flux de travail global sans avoir à les importer
eux.

2voto

Robaticus Points 14665

Vous pouvez exporter le modèle de processus agile sur disque, puis importer les éléments de travail dans votre projet existant. Vous aurez peut-être besoin des outils électriques TFS pour ce faire.

1voto

Vaccano Points 18515

Je suis peut-être trop tard pour cette question, mais la TSF Plate-forme d'Intégration d'outils pourrait vraiment aider ici.

Voir cette question sur le serveur faute de détails sur la façon de passer de Mêlée De l'Équipe Système V2 pour Microsoft Visual Studio Scrum 1.0.

Vous devez configurer votre propre mappages de se déplacer à partir de vos modèles à la cible de modèle, mais le processus est le même.

0voto

Je pense que la meilleure façon d'y parvenir est de créer un nouveau Projet d'Équipe avec "le nouveau" modèle de processus et d'utilisation de la TSF à l'Intégration de l'outil de migrer votre système existant des WorkItems et choisissez de créer une nouvelle branche à partir de la Source de Contrôle, de sorte que vous aurez de nouveaux Éléments de travail (avec le nouveau flux de travail) et le contrôle de la source de l'histoire (bien). Vous auriez même le faire à travers les versions de TFS!! (Dans le cas intéressées à migrer TFS 2005/2008/2010)

Un autre moyen pourrait être d'utiliser le WorkItem Modèles, mais je pense que c'est plus une sorte de style visuel (je n'ai pas beaucoup d'expérience) appliquée à l'Élément de Travail. Pour ce faire, faites un clic droit sur votre projet, importer le WITDefinition et d'appliquer le modèle en sélectionnant Appliquer le modèle souhaité en WorkITems.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X